Transaction 4fc2e1aef7986f3edb00715ad96d20ee538b257888f635a14f62dbef84c98bdb
1 Input
1 Outputs
- 4fc2e1aef7986f3edb00715ad96d20ee538b257888f635a14f62dbef84c98bdb:0
value 100993021
address n3wMXxfF4hjDsBZHi4XR6JsJDmCg58t71b